Direct Support Professional III - 1st Shift (OIDD-Midlands)
NEOGOV is seeking a Direct Support Professional to join their Department of Behavioral Health and Developmental Disabilities team dedicated to providing compassionate care. This role involves supervising Direct Support Professional I and II staff, ensuring compliance with consumer support plans, and monitoring the safety and care of individ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ities.

Responsibilities
Responsible for the supervisory functions of the Direct Support Professional I's and II's
Ensures that all documentation required for the consumers Individual Support Plan (ISP) have been completed and monitors the safety and care of consumers
Ensures Active Treatment for consumers in assigned buildings is implemented by staff. This entails monitorship programs developed by the Interdisciplinary (ID) Team. Monitors completion of behavior data sheets, ISP training programs, and GER (General Event Reports) to ensure all required documentation is entered into THERAP. Monitors Day Programs monthly (i.e. on/off campus)
Responsible for reporting significant events and suspected abuse immediately per Agency and Office policy and procedures
Performs additional duties as assigned
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's Degree and one (1) year experience working with individuals with intellectual or developmental disabilities; or an equivalent combination of education and experience
Preferred
Knowledge of federal and state regulations governing ICF-IID, as well as directives relevant to an ICF
Ability to exercise sound judgment, comply with all required regulations and procedures; be a team leader and maintain effective working relationships
Computer skills, as well as excellent written and verbal communication skills
Ability to work with individuals who may be physically aggressive or medically fragile
Ability to work in a fast-paced work environment, which includes standing, walking, stooping, bending and pulling
